Output 698681cefc74856f0f9f486bc42a9c5a8aa94ac67f50c346195184e29b703e0c:1

value
18756319
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9bd8a0493620b7da6a3ffe1f2d5e436a4a09c9cb OP_EQUALVERIFY OP_CHECKSIG
address
1FD3FBTCZw2yJLD5CqkknVwdteRXAamu8v
transaction
698681cefc74856f0f9f486bc42a9c5a8aa94ac67f50c346195184e29b703e0c
spent
true